Sometimes you can adjust the settings in your video driver, but it tends to make the screen look really strange (try it and you'll see what I mean).

If you're willing to open up your monitor, there should be two screws located somewhere on it which control the focus and brightness. Tightening the brightness screw will usually fix this.

Keep in mind that opening your monitor is far more dangerous than opening your computer. If you're not experienced with this, I wouldn't try it. Parts in the monitor can store dangerously high voltages, even after leaving it unplugged for days. It's pretty difficult to seriously injure yourself when opening a computer, but pretty easy when opening a monitor!
 
I agree with ceew1... opening a moniotr case without a thorough understanding of electronics is just asking for trouble... a CRT can store a 35,000vdc charge for months while disconnected.

Adjusting the G2 pot would increase overall CRT brightness, however, adjusting it too high can cause physical damage to the CRT.
 
Anything you do from a software side will more than likely just whitebalance (or rather, unbalance) the image :)
